WebMar 16, 2024 · The Convert.ToBase64String () method converts an array of bytes to a base64 string variable in C#. To convert a string variable to a base64 string, we must first convert that string to an array of bytes. The Encoding.UTF8.GetBytes () method is converts a string variable to an array of bytes in C#. WebAug 1, 2007 · To answer the question: If the byte array represents an ASCII encoded string, you should use ASCII encoding, if it represents an UTF-8 encoded string, you should use UTF-8 encoding, etc. If it doesn't represent a string at all, you should use other technics like a base-64 string (Convert.ToBase64String). WebSep 28, 2024 · The UTF8 decoder is not always able to transform all the bytes into chars, since some chars have up to 4 bytes, and maybe not all are present in the buffer, that is why bytesUsed is very important. – vtortola Sep 29, 2024 at 12:57 @vtortola: You are certainly right.
